Kenta Kobashi announces retirement - end of NOAH?

It's been quite the week for Pro Wrestling NOAH. Reports of Kenta Kobashi being fired for cost cutting reasons, top stars leaving the company in protest, capped off by Kobashi announcing his retirement at Sumo Hall due to a catalogue of injuries.

Pro Wrestling NOAH's future in question after Yakuza scandal

From the death of Pride Fighting Championships, it's well known that the Yakuza are heavily involved in the Japanese combat sport's dark underbelly and that taboo subject being made public can be a kiss of death. NOAH were forced to make management figures Ryu Nakata and Haruka Eigen resign after their Yakuza ties were formally revealed.
